Title :
Galileo return-link experiment using Galileo receiver and simulator

Abstract :
The Galileo satellite of MEOSAR (Medium Earth Orbit Search And Rescue) system will has the function of return link for search and rescue (SAR) service. MCC (Mission Control Center) sends the return-link message via Galileo E1-B signal to EPIRB, PLB or ELT user. Cospas-sarsat considers a beacon response for acknowledgement message and beacon control with the parameter definition of RLM (Return Link Message) SAR data field. We conducted the function test of Galileo/SAR return link with Galileo signal simulator and Galileo Receiver to define the RLM parameters which is still open.
